Description: Three homes were struck by lightning as thunderstorms swept through NSW, with 10 people evacuated from one building after a roof collapse. NSW Fire Brigades Superintendent Ian Krimmer said crews went to a three-storey building in Templeman Crescent, Hillsdale, in Sydney's southeast, after reports of an explosion at about 3.30pm (AEDT) on Friday. Officers on the scene reported the building had been struck by lightning and 10 people had to be evacuated. A NSW State Emergency Service (SES) spokeswoman said the roof of the building had collapsed. An elderly woman was treated at the scene for shock, Supt Krimmer said. Two other houses in the Wollongong area were also struck by lightning on Friday afternoon. Fire crews were called to a home on Osborne Parade, Warilla, at about 3.40pm (AEDT) after it was hit, causing extensive damage to the roof. The SES was called to the scene to provide tarpaulins for the roof. The third house, at Berkeley Road, Gwynneville, suffered no apparent damage when it was struck. Heavy rainfall caused delays on the South Coast rail line, a RailCorp spokesman said. The Bureau of Meteorology issued a severe thunderstorm warning for many parts of NSW for Friday afternoon.
